A Short Term Lease Apartments in Ebrington is a legal contract that indicates that a lessee will give services or monetary compensation to a lessor in exchange for temporary possession (not ownership) of property. People and firms may use short term leases for almost any property. In most cases, a short term lease lasts less than a year (generally one month to six months), but some industries may define short term leases as continuing two or three years.

As with regular monthly rentals, all details regarding deposits and additional fees must be comprised in the lease. For vacation rentals, common additional costs may arise from cleaning fees and hotel taxes. Extra fees may also be incurred for pets or other individuals at the property, remains beyond the checkout time, property damage and telephone use. A damage deposit or reservation deposit is a lease demand to hold the property. Terms for the return of a damage deposit should be spelled out. Complete payment for the vacation rental is required before the arrival date--occasionally up to 30 days before check in.

When letting a furnished flat to protect your investment, it is wise to provide the tenant with an itemized list of the items contained in the flat rental. Be really specific; list the number of plates, bowls, and cups, for example, and describe things as accurately as possible. List the replacement cost of each item if the tenant chooses the piece with him when he moves out, or if it is damaged beyond ordinary wear and tear. Indicate if the replacement cost will be required out of the security deposit, or if the tenant will must pay you directly for the items. Have the tenant sign a copy of this inventory so there are not any surprises when the lease comes to an end.

Any service that incurs a fee should be contained in the lease, including phone use, garbage, laundry, housekeeping, and parking. Occasionally, elective services are accessible, like daily housekeeping services along with cleaning upon departure. These should be, at the absolute minimum, recorded on the lease in case the vacationers choose to make use of the service after they arrive. Expectations about the usage of the property should also be clearly indicated--either in the lease or via a procedures manual referenced in the contract. Who cleans the grill? Who takes out the garbage and where does it go? Should the sheets be stripped housekeeping or by by the vacationers? Must the dishes be washed before housekeeping arrives? All of these are issues which should be addressed avert conflicts over the stay and the lease and to ensure a smooth holiday.

The dates and times of arrival and departure are spelled out in great specificity in the vacation rental lease. Vacationers are coming and going every week--sometimes every few days--and the units must be cleaned between stays. To avert vacancy between stays, the time between check-in and checkout is usually a comparatively short window. And because some vacationers rely on air transportation, there are occasionally last minute requests to arrive or depart late or early. It's, therefore, crucial that you include eventuality requests in the lease, indicating both a procedure and a cost to change agreed upon plans.
